회사 개요

Cadeler A/S operates as a specialized offshore wind installation vessel contractor, facilitating the transport and installation of offshore wind turbine generators and foundations across Denmark, the United Kingdom, Germany, Poland, the rest of Europe, the United States, and Taiwan. The company functions within the Industrials sector, specifically the Engineering & Construction industry, where it provides critical infrastructure services essential for the expansion of renewable energy capacity. Its scale is defined by a market capitalization of $2.52 billion, annual revenue of $620.35 million, and an employee base of 1,073 individuals. Cadeler A/S 소개

Cadeler A/S, together with its subsidiaries, operates as an offshore wind installation vessel contractor in Denmark, the United Kingdom, Germany, Poland, rest of Europe, the United States, and Taiwan. The company engages in the transport and installation of offshore wind turbine generators, foundations, and topsides and substations; maintenance of offshore wind turbine generators, and offshore structures and platforms; and offshore construction within the renewable space. It is also involved offshore decommissioning within the renewable space; salvage assistance; and heavy lift and project cargo. In addition, the company owns and operates ten offshore jack-up windfarm installation vessels. Cadeler A/S was incorporated in 2008 and is headquartered in Copenhagen, Denmark.
